
Miles Davis: Birth of the Cool
An immersive look at the eventful life and brilliant artistic career of visionary American jazz trumpeter Miles Davis (1926-1991).
Genre: Documentary, History, Music
Director: Stanley Nelson
Actors: Ashley Kahn, Benjamin Cawthra, Carl Lumbly, Dan Morgenstern, Farah Griffin, Jimmy Cobb, Jimmy Heath, Lee Annie Bonner, Quincy Troupe, Reginald Petty
Country: United States
